Regarding buying appliances: don't just look for the store with the cheapest prices (they're basically all about the same anyway). You should think about: how will the store respond when you have a problem. I'm a self-confessed pain in the neck type of customer because I'm very indecisive and picky. I also had some snafus (all my fault--like ordering the wrong size hood and changing my mind about the custom oven I bought). Throughout all of this, Smiley was unfailingly kind and professional. He provided honest advice on the products and when things went sideways for me, he went out of his way to fix the problem and make sure I was happy and satisfied.
